The Nether presents unique environmental challenges that demand specialized bridge designs. Navigating this hazardous dimension requires structures that can withstand lava exposure, hostile mob encounters, and the Nether’s unstable terrain. Building effective bridges here significantly improves your mobility and safety while resource gathering or exploring fortress locations.
The referenced Nether bridge utilizes locally sourced materials like nether brick, blackstone, and basalt for both structural integrity and thematic consistency. This design emphasizes wide pathways for safe ghast evasion and incorporates strategic lighting to prevent mob spawning. For enhanced safety, consider adding side railings using iron bars or nether brick fences, which provide protection without obstructing visibility.

Construction Tip: Always carry a fire resistance potion when building over extensive lava lakes. Place soul torches or lanterns every 5-7 blocks to maintain adequate mob-spawn prevention while conserving resources.
Drawing inspiration from The Witcher 3’s iconic Skellige archipelago, this bridge design replicates the dramatic mountain-spanning structures that define the region’s landscape. The original Skellige bridge connects mountainous terrain to castle fortifications, standing at imposing heights that create both visual spectacle and practical passage.
In Minecraft recreation, focus on using stone variants—including cobblestone, stone bricks, and andesite—to achieve authentic texture variation. The construction requires careful planning for elevation changes and foundation stability on uneven mountain terrain. For authenticity, incorporate decorative elements like worn stone textures using mossy cobblestone and cracked stone bricks at strategic locations.

Advanced Technique: Use scaffolding during construction for safe access to high elevation points. Implement supporting arches beneath the main span for both structural reinforcement and visual appeal. This bridge typically requires 2-3 hours to complete for intermediate builders.
Hogwarts Castle’s covered bridge represents one of the most recognizable magical architectures in popular culture. This design features enclosed walkways with supportive beam structures and characteristic roof covering, providing both weather protection and defensive advantages in survival mode.
The Reddit-inspired redesign improves upon the original’s deteriorated appearance while maintaining its essential magical character. Key features include the enclosed middle section, exposed beam supports, and the distinctive tower connections at both ends. The covered design offers practical benefits including protection from weather elements and ranged mob attacks.

Building Mistake to Avoid: Don’t use flammable materials like wood in close proximity to lava or fire-based mob farms. Instead, consider stone brick or nether brick alternatives for fire-prone environments.
Not every bridge needs to be an engineering marvel—sometimes simplicity creates the most harmonious results. The mossy bridge design excels in natural integration with forest biomes, village perimeters, and peaceful water crossings. This approach prioritizes aesthetic blending with the environment over structural complexity.
This design utilizes mossy cobblestone, various grass blocks, and strategic vegetation placement to create structures that appear to have existed within the landscape naturally.

Customization Options: Enhance with glow lichen or shroomlights for subtle nighttime illumination. Add flower pots with small plants along the edges or create slight arches using stripped oak logs for enhanced visual interest without significant construction complexity.
For builders seeking to create truly monumental structures, the Bridge of Lords represents the pinnacle of medieval-inspired bridge design. This elaborate construction features multiple architectural layers, extensive decorative elements, and functional spaces within the bridge structure itself.
The design incorporates varied block types including stone bricks, deepslate, and polished andesite to create visual depth and texture variation. The substantial foundation allows for integration of functional spaces like small rest areas, defensive positions, or even mini-trading posts.

Construction Planning: This advanced project requires approximately 4-6 hours for experienced builders. Begin with a detailed foundation plan and consider building in creative mode first to perfect your design before attempting in survival.
